Experts advice extreme caution as there is a possibility of a fresh wave in Diwali - Omicron BF.7 in India

With Diwali just a week away, health experts have advised caution as the covid variants BA.7 and BA.5.1.7 are said to be highly infectious with greater transmissibility.Omicron sub-variants -- BA.5.1.7 and BF.7 -- after emerging from a region of Mongolia in China are now making their way to other parts and posing fresh threats. Health experts have suggested extra precautions to be taken since the five-day Diwali festival involves a lot of parties and get-togethers. Social distancing and masking up remain the primary defence against the lethal virus.Scientists have said that BF.7 can escape the antibodies from earlier illnesses or vaccinations better than the many other omicron sub-variants, according to two studies.Even though no death has been reported in the last two days, Delhi saw 135 fresh cases of Covid-19. The city saw 112 cases last week with a test positivity rate of 1.75 per cent while on Saturday, the number of cases was 130, with a positivity rate of 1.84 per cent. ...
